Gather Your Savory Stuffing Bites Ingredients

To make these delicious little bites,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• 2 cups prepared stuffing mix
  • 1/2 lb (225 g) sausage, cooked and crumbled
  • 1/2 cup (50 g) sh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up (25 g) chopped onions
  • 1/4 cup (15 g) f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 2 tbsp (30 ml) butter, melted

How to Make Savory Stuffing Bites

  1. Preheat your o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) and grease a mini muffin tin to prevent sticking.
  2. In a skillet, cook the sausage over medium heat until it’s browned and fully cooked. Be sure to drain any excess fat afterwards.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ked sausage, stuffing mix, chopped onions, shredded cheddar, parsley, and garlic powder.
  4. Add the melted butter to the mixture and stir well until everything is combined.
  5. Spoon the mixture into the muffin tin, packing it gently to hold the shape.
  6. Bake for about 10-12 minutes, or until the bites are golden brown and crispy on top.
  7. Let them cool slightly before removing from the pan.

Helpful Tricks for Savory Stuffing Bites

  • If you’re feeling creative, you can customize the filling! Try adding different types of cheese like mozzarella or pepper jack for a spicy kick.
  • For those who prefer a bit more texture, consider adding some chopped bell peppers or mushrooms to the mixture.
  • You can prepare the mixture 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ator. Just bake them fresh for your guests when you’re ready!

Savory Stuffing Bites: Frequently Asked Questions

Can I substitute the sausage for something else?
Absolutely! You can use ground turkey or chicken sausage, or even a plant-based sausage for a delicious vegetarian version.

How do I store leftovers?
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. You can reheat them in the oven or microwave.

Can I freeze Savory Stuffing Bites?
Yes, you can freeze them! Just place the baked bites in a single layer on a baking sheet, freeze until solid, and then transfer them to a freezer-safe container. Bake from frozen for a quick snack later!
